San Martino
San Martino is a 16th-century, Roman Catholic church in Burano, an island of the city of Venice, region of the Veneto, Italy. The church was reconsecrated in 1645.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 2.0.

Mazzorbo
Photo: Zairon,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Mazzorbo is one of various islands in the northern part of the Lagoon of Venice. Like the other islands in this part of the lagoon, it was the site of one of the earliest settlements in the lagoon which predated the development of Venice.
Torcello
Photo: Abxbay,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Torcello is a sparsely populated island at the northern end of the Venetian Lagoon, in north-eastern Italy. It was first settled in 452 AD and has been referred to as the parent island from which Venice was populated.
Lace Museum
Museum
Photo: Abxbay,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Lace Museum is located at the historic palace of Podestà of Torcello, in Galuppi square, on the island of Burano, near Venice, Italy. The palace was seat of the famous Burano Lace School from 1872 to 1970.

Burano
Photo: Massimo Telò,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Burano is an island in the Venetian Lagoon, northern Italy, near Torcello at the northern end of the lagoon, known for its lace work and brightly coloured homes. The primary economy is tourism.

Punta Sabbioni
Village
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Punta Sabbioni is a hamlet in the municipality of Cavallino-Treporti, near Venice, Italy. It is located at the southern end of Cavallino, a peninsula which separates the Venetian Lagoon from the Adriatic Sea. Punta Sabbioni is situated 4 km south of San Martino.
